2006 Panoz Esperante vs. 2008 Renault Logan

To start off, 2008 Renault Logan is newer by 2 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2006 Panoz Esperante.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2006 Panoz Esperante would be higher. At 4,589 cc (8 cylinders), 2006 Panoz Esperante is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2006 Panoz Esperante (305 HP @ 5800 RPM) has 219 more horse power than 2008 Renault Logan. (86 HP @ 5500 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2006 Panoz Esperante should accelerate faster than 2008 Renault Logan.

Because 2006 Panoz Esperante is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2006 Panoz Esperante.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2008 Renault Logan,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2006 Panoz Esperante (434 Nm @ 4200 RPM) has 306 more torque (in Nm) than 2008 Renault Logan. (128 Nm @ 3000 RPM). This means 2006 Panoz Esperante will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2008 Renault Logan.
